One of the key aspects of airline GSA agreements is the ability for an airline to enter into a partnership with a GSA in a foreign market. This allows the airline to leverage the GSA`s local expertise, infrastructure, and network to reach customers in that market. In return, the GSA receives the rights to sell the airline`s products and services in that territory.

Key Components of Airline GSA Agreements

Let`s take a look at of the Key Components of Airline GSA Agreements:

Component Description
Duration The length of time for which the GSA has the rights to represent the airline in the market.
Exclusivity Whether the GSA has exclusive rights to sell the airline`s products and services in the market, or if the airline can work with other GSAs or sell directly.
Performance Targets Specific sales and marketing targets that the GSA is expected to meet during the term of the agreement.
Compensation The financial terms of the agreement, including commission rates, payment terms, and any other financial arrangements.

1. What is an airline GSA agreement? An airline GSA agreement is a legal contract between an airline and a General Sales Agent (GSA), which gives the GSA the authority to represent the airline in a specific market or region. 2. What are the key components of an airline GSA agreement? The key components of an airline GSA agreement include the scope of the GSA`s authority, sales targets, marketing activities, financial arrangements, termination clauses, and dispute resolution mechanisms. These components are crucial in defining the rights and obligations of both the airline and the GSA.

9. What are the implications of competition laws in an airline GSA agreement? Competition laws may have implications on an airline GSA agreement, particularly in relation to pricing, market allocation, and anti-competitive practices. It is important for both the airline and the GSA to ensure compliance with relevant competition laws to avoid legal sanctions and reputational damage.
